The laptop screen is one of the most important parts of the laptop. If its screen is damaged, it can impair your usage of your laptop. Replacing the screen can fix any visual problems you have.

Flip the laptop so that the bottom is facing upwards.
-
-
-
Slide the battery lock switch to the left.
-
-
-
Pull the sliding switch to the right and continue to hold it in this position.
-
-
-
While holding the switch, slide the battery away from you.
-
-
-
Remove the two circled 4mm screws with a J1 screwdriver.
-
-
-
-
Remove the two circled 5mm screws with a J1 screwdriver.
-
-
-
Use a spudger to pry up the plastic panel between the keyboard the screen.
-
Repeat on opposite side of laptop.
-
Tilt the laptop's screen back.
-
Lift the panel and remove it from the laptop.
-
-
-
Unclip the keyboard from the laptop by lifting it.
-
Slide the keyboard slightly towards the screen.
-
Lift the keyboard out of the way.
-
-
-
Pull the ribbon cable straight out of the connector.
-
-
-
Remove the two circled 5mm screws with a J1 screwdriver.
-
-
-
Unscrew the two circled screws with a J1 screwdriver. The screws will remain attached to the plastic panel.
-
Lift the panel and remove it from the laptop.
-
-
-
Gently lift and detach the grey and black antennae cables that are attached to the blue circuitboard.
-
-
-
Flip the laptop over.
-
Pull the black and grey cables out of the laptop, towards the laptop screen.
-
-
-
Detach the black cable from the computer by pulling it to the right.
-
-
-
Lift the screen away from the laptop.
-
To reassemble your device, follow these instructions in reverse order.
